York United and Atlético Ottawa split the points on Friday night at York Lions Stadium after a feisty second half, which saw both teams score twice to ultimately draw 2-2. Brian Wright put the visitors on the board shortly after halftime, but Osaze De Rosario scored from the penalty spot to level the game at a goal apiece. Ballou Tabla appeared to have won it for Ottawa with a quick goal in the 86th minute, but with almost the final play of the game, defender Dominick Zator was the hero for York with a shot from inside the box to make it 2-2.
